21 #ifndef bempp_acc_hpp
22 #define bempp_acc_hpp
23 
26 #include "common.hpp"
27 
28 namespace Bempp
29 {
30 
37 template <typename Container>
38 inline typename Container::reference acc(Container& v, typename Container::size_type i)
39 {
40 #ifdef NDEBUG
41  return v[i];
42 #else
43  return v.at(i);
44 #endif
45 }
46 
53 template <typename Container>
54 inline typename Container::const_reference acc(const Container& v, typename Container::size_type i)
55 {
56 #ifdef NDEBUG
57  return v[i];
58 #else
59  return v.at(i);
60 #endif
61 }
62 
63 } // namespace Bempp
64 
65 #endif
